Your role:

The MGA Insurance Reconciliation Specialist is a key contributor in overseeing the monthly bordereaux reconciliation process for our MGA clients. This role demands strong financial acumen, advanced Excel proficiency, and effective communication with both clients and U.S.-based and offshore team members. The specialist is responsible for ensuring the accuracy of billing and payment records, identifying and resolving discrepancies, and supporting the team’s overall efficiency and client satisfaction.

After 3 months you will:

  • Manage and reconcile monthly bordereaux submissions, ensuring accuracy between client data, internal systems, and cashbooks.
  • Identify and resolve discrepancies between expected billing and actual payments, maintaining detailed audit logs.
  • Act as the main liaison for reconciliation issues between internal teams and MGA clients, ensuring clear and timely communication.
  • Investigate and resolve billing variances, escalating complex issues when necessary.
  • Track and document client interactions, KPIs, and outcomes using CRM tools and client platforms.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ally to address client challenges and enhance workflow efficiency.
  • Support offshore teams with feedback and guidance to improve processing accuracy and integration.
  • Contribute to team meetings, retrospectives, and continuous process improvements to strengthen team performance and culture.
